About WorkMoney
WorkMoney is dedicated to lowering costs and raising incomes for all Americans to make American life more affordable and American families more economically secure. We provide products, services, perks, benefits, tips, and tools to help members improve their financial lives, and we have become a trusted source of information about financial matters, economic policy, and public debates about the economy for our 4 million (and growing) members. We are in the midst of a growth period as an organization and as a brand. In 2023, we will be increasing our presence and investment across a broader range of paid, owned, earned and shared channels which will enable us to advance our core vision that everyone in America can afford to live a good life.
